Most men, when it comes to Valentine's gifts...are clueless. Take my friend "Steve" (I am changing names to protect the guilty here). Last Valentine's Day, his wife "Brenda" mentioned that she'd put on a few extra pounds since the birth of their son, and would really like to get back into an exercise program and see if she couldn't get it off. Steve took this as a hint, which it wasn't, and off he went with their three children to the local Wal-mart. He allowed their daughter to help him pick out several pairs of colorful exercise shorts and matching spandex tops. The spandex looked little, so he decided to buy an X-Large in everything to make sure it fit. Time out...did I mention that Brenda might weigh 110 pounds soaking wet?
Then it was off to the shoe department where the middle son chose a pair of aerobic trainers. Steve was ecstatic with his choice, because the shoes even had the little colored tabs that Brenda could switch out to match each of her new outfits.
The next stop was sporting goods, where he loaded up a pink rubber Yoga mat, a selection of weights, a jump rope, a fitness ball and a small trampoline. As he started out of the aisle, he saw a set of scales on an end cap that were on sale, and quickly added those to his loot.
"Mommy's going to be so happy with me!" He announced to the baby, who simply gurgled at him as they headed to Electronics. Locating the Fitness DVD's, he found a series of Pilates and Abdominal burners in a nice boxed set, with a full 2 hours of work-outs on each of the 8 disks.
He took the kids to McDonalds and fed them hamburgers and milkshakes, went home and wrapped his gifts. "For once" he thought to himself, "I don't have to worry that I got her the wrong thing."
Ladies, I know that by now, you've probably laughed yourself into hysterics and the guys are still wondering what Steve did wrong.
